    Abstract: A lift pin actuator includes a castellated annulus, a first arm, a second arm, and a pin pad. The annulus arranged along a rotation axis and has a first merlon and a second merlon circumferentially separated by a crenel. The first arm is connected to the first merlon and extends outward from the annulus, the second arm is connected to the second merlon and extends outward from the annulus, and the second arm is circumferentially spaced from the first arm by a radial gap. The pin pad is connected to the annulus by the first arm and the second arm, is radially spaced from the annulus by the radial gap, and radially overlaps the crenel to nest a support member within the lift pin actuator during translation of the lift pin actuator along the rotation axis relative to the support member. Process kits, semiconductor processing systems, methods of making lift pin actuators and related material layer deposition methods are also described.

    Abstract: This invention relates to a multi-part kit system to repair damaged products used in industrial applications, comprising a part A which comprises A1) MDI prepolymer, A2) fumed silica and A3) plasticizer; a part B which comprises B1) hydroquinone di-(2-hydroxyethyl)ether and B2) plasticizer; and a part C which comprises C1) polyol, C2) optionally catalyst and C3) optionally plasticizer.

    Abstract: A turbine rotor disc includes a plurality of attachment slots for receiving firtree-profiled blade roots. Each attachment slot is formed in an undulating profile having substantially smoothly curved and laterally, alternately recessed and projecting portions. At least one pair of substantially smoothly curved projecting portions being truncated at a tip thereof, respectively.

    Abstract: There is provided a locator device and an associated fixture and method for supporting a rotatable member. The locator device has a base and a plurality of flanges extending from the base in an axial direction and arranged circumferentially to define an aperture for at least partially receiving the rotatable member axially. The flanges defining slots for receiving radial portions of the rotatable member with the radial portions extending radially outward from the flanges. Thus, the locator device can support boreless rotatable members so that a tool can be supported against the radial portions of the rotatable member to thereby form the rotatable member to predetermined dimensions.
